Transaction 286b16951dcee14eaab5768f07cff36c457ccc50986662fc2aa527aa28905066

1 Input
2 Outputs
  • 286b16951dcee14eaab5768f07cff36c457ccc50986662fc2aa527aa28905066:0
  • value  2000000
    address  1PbmBL2ZBQq4YasHW8c7RF75MWoUbG5dsk
  • 286b16951dcee14eaab5768f07cff36c457ccc50986662fc2aa527aa28905066:1
  • value  6823975
    address  16x1SZbEGyRoZmSnju5fdu9dt7sPKzUmyy